Bathroom Space Savers
In almost all bathrooms, storage space is at a premium. Bathrooms need to store all types of items that are used not only in the bathroom, but in the rest of the house as well. The bathroom can essentially be referred to as an extra closet due to the amount things that get stored in it. Most times, items that are stored in a bathroom are items such as bath towels, bed linens, cosmetics, medicines, toiletries, bath soaps and shampoos and so on. As you can see, all these items can quickly take up a lot of space, and therefore bathroom space savers can really help to add the additional storage that you need.
The options for bathroom space savers are so large that many times it is hard to choose which type of space saver to use. You could use bathroom shelves, shower shelves, and under sink storage to name a few. Here, we will look at each of these on more detail.
Bathroom Shelves
Bathroom shelves can be added to many different locations in a bathroom. You could add them to existing cabinets, install some on a wall, or add some to a bathroom closet. They are great bathroom space savers because they are easily installed and don't sit on the floor, therefore you don't lose any valuable floor space.
Usually, the best cabinet to add bathroom shelves to is the sink cabinet. This cabinet is usually empty besides maybe a garbage bin and some cleaning supplies, so you can easily gain some storage space by adding a few shelves to the cabinet.
If you want to add some wood bathroom shelves to a wall, consider adding them above your toilet as this space is not usually used for anything. The shelves will never be in the way, and can help you store things like extra towels or extra toilet paper.
Shower Shelves
Another one of the best bathroom space savers is to use shower shelves. These shelves are usually installed in a corner of a shower by drilling into the wall or by the use of suction cups. You can also find shower shelves that hang from the shower head, which means that you won't have any type of installation mess and can easily hide the shelves when needed.
Under Sink Storage
Besides installing shelves under your sink, you can use other great bathroom space savers under the sink such as drawer units or wire baskets. By stacking these items, you can take advantage of the under sink storage space to the right and left of the sink, which is often full height. You can also use a drawer kit to turn the drawer blank that covers the sink into a small fold-out basket, which can hold smaller items.
